Diana T. Schaffer

MARQUETTE, MI-Diana T. Schaffer, 86, of Ishpeming, passed away peacefully on Tuesday, October 28, 2025, at her home, surrounded by her loving family and under the care of Lake Superior Life Care and Hospice.

Diana was born on July 29, 1939, in Detroit, MI, to Joseph and Mary (Paulikis) Liepinaitis. She graduated with the class of 1958 from St. Cecilia High School in Detroit and later attended the Detroit Business Institute in downtown Detroit.

Diana worked for Automotive News in Detroit for many years before she and her husband, Frank, relocated to Michigan’s Upper Peninsula. Together, they co-owned and operated Ace Hardware and Ace Heating and Contracting in Ishpeming.

An accomplished artist, Diana had a natural talent and passion for art. She also loved fishing, baking for friends and family, and was a devoted homemaker. Her family was the center of her life. Diana had a special fondness for dogs and was known for her kind and nurturing spirit.

She was a member of St. Peter Cathedral in Marquette, where she participated in the St. Peter Cathedral Prayer Line and was a member of the former Perpetual Adoration Group. Diana held a deep devotion to Our Lady, Mary, Mother of Jesus. She and Frank were also proud members of the Polish Club of Munising and Marquette.

Diana is survived by her husband, Frank C. Schaffer of Ishpeming; her daughter, Donna (Tod) Poirier of Ishpeming; sister-in-law, Mary Liepinaitis of Romeo, MI; and several nieces and nephews.

She was preceded in death by her father, Joseph Liepinaitis; her mother and stepfather, Mary and James Samuels; and her brother, Joseph Liepinaitis.
